Profile
Revenue comes from lumber, North American engineered wood, pulp and paper, and European engineered wood products. The Norbord acquisition made OSB and European operations central to the portfolio.
Produces lumber alongside North American engineered wood products—OSB, LVL, MDF, plywood, and particleboard—and also operates pulp and paper and European engineered wood businesses.
Canadian operations remain central, while a long expansion in the U.S. South and the Norbord acquisition built a footprint spanning Canada, the United States, the United Kingdom, and Europe. The company has grown through mills and timber-linked assets, then refocused its portfolio around wood products.
Low-cost operations, reinvestment, safe operations, and stewardship of renewable forest resources are stated operating priorities. Canadian softwood-lumber trade disputes and related countervailing and antidumping duties shape the business.
